• COURSE DESCRIPTION

    This course offers an in-depth exploration of bisexuality and pansexuality, guided by clinical psychologist Dr. Lana Holmes. Through rich conversation, the episode explores definitions, cultural history, identity erasure, mental health disparities, and the intersectional factors that shape bi and pan experiences. Clinicians will gain a greater understanding of how to recognize and address the unique challenges bi and pan clients face, particularly around identity invalidation, repeated coming out, and intra-community marginalization. Practical strategies and resources are provided to support clinicians in creating affirming, inclusive therapeutic environments.

  • LEARNING OBJECTIVES

    Upon completing this course, participants will be able to: Identify at least three unique challenges faced by bi and pan individuals in both heterosexual and LGBTQIA2S+ communities; Describe how cultural and systemic factors contribute to bi and pan erasure and internalized stigma; List three or more clinical strategies for creating affirming spaces for bi and pan clients in therapeutic settings.

Interviewer and Interviewee

Dr. Lana Holmes, PSY

Gender and Sexuality Expert

Lana Holmes, Psy.D., is a licensed clinical psychologist at the Center for Inclusive Therapy + Wellness. Specifically, she is licensed to practice therapy and teletherapy within GA, as well as interjurisdictional teletherapy via PsyPact. But more than that, she is a Black bisexual woman, an Air Force brat, and a punk rocker at heart.
Dr. Holmes is passionate about co-facilitating healing for people who acknowledge the multifaceted nature of their lives and identities. Her areas of clinical interest and expertise include the intersection between mental health and spirituality; BDSM, kink, and ethical non-monogamy issues; matters relating to BIPOC individuals; concerns relating to LGBTQIA2S+ folks, trauma across the lifespan, life transitions, anxiety disorders, and depressive disorders.
Her collaborative approach to treatment tailors evidence-based interventions to each person’s needs. Moreover, as a nerd, she is interested in how pop culture and the arts can help illustrate both the human and clinical experience.
